Dalmuir Train Station is well-equipped with modern amenities designed to cater to both seasoned travelers and occasional train users. Ticket purchasing is hassle-free with a ticket office open from 05:45 to midnight on weekdays and open from 08:10 to midnight on Sundays. For added convenience, ticket machines are available along with accessible versions for ease of use. There's no need to fret about collecting tickets bought online, as pick-up at ticket machines is straightforward and efficient.
While waiting for your train, you can relax in the comfortable seating areas or use the accessible toilets available on-site. Although there's no dedicated first-class lounge, the waiting room promises comfort. For cycling enthusiasts, the station offers bike racks with CCTV protection, ensuring your ride is safely stored during your travels.
Accessibility is a priority at Dalmuir Station. It boasts step-free access, ensuring easy navigation through the station's grounds. There are four accessible parking spaces as well as an impaired mobility pick-up and set-down point, making the station welcoming for those with mobility challenges. With induction loops, ramps for train access, and a Passenger Assist service for travelers requiring special assistance, the station emphasizes a worry-free journey for everyone.

Keeping your travel needs in mind, Walton-on-Thames station provides a variety of amenities for all. The ticket office operates from 06:10 to 20:40 on weekdays and Saturdays, and from 08:10 to 19:40 on Sundays. Ticket machines are available for convenient access to tickets, including options for those using Disabled Persons Railcards. The station is equipped with smartcard validators, enabling the use of modern ticketing methods.
For those requiring special assistance, step-free access is thoughtfully provided to both platforms via ramps and lifts, and induction loops are available to aid those with hearing devices. Accessible toilets and baby changing facilities ensure comfort for all passengers, while a heated waiting area in the booking hall offers a cozy place to rest. However, please note that there's no staff help available, so getting in touch with the train guard for any assistance is recommended.
Walton-on-Thames station is linked with various transport options to help you continue your journey. While there isn't a formal taxi rank, there is a taxi office nearby for your needs. Those preferring buses can find comprehensive journey planning online, with printable information readily accessible here. If there’s ever a need for rail replacement services, they are accommodated at the station forecourt on Station Avenue.
